Legal Landscape of Sports Betting in Canada
Sports betting in Canada is regulated at the provincial level. Since the legalization of single-event sports betting, provinces have been able to offer and regulate their own platforms. As a result, many provinces now operate government-run betting sites, while international operators also serve Canadian players where permitted. This structure ensures that Canadian bettors can enjoy sports wagering in a regulated, transparent, and safer environment.

Sports Coverage and Betting Markets
Canadian sports betting sites cover a wide variety of sports. Hockey, especially the NHL, remains the most popular choice among Canadian bettors. Other widely bet-on sports include basketball (NBA), baseball (MLB), American football (NFL), soccer, tennis, and combat sports. Many sites also provide betting markets for Canadian leagues and international tournaments.
Betting options usually include moneyline bets, point spreads, totals (over/under), prop bets, and futures. This variety allows both beginners and experienced bettors to find wagers that suit their knowledge and risk tolerance.
